LATE or non-payment for services by government departments and agencies is adversely affecting the sustainability of entrepreneurs and small businesses.
Speaking at the launch of the small, micro and medium enterprises hotline in Pretoria yesterday Trade and Industry Minister Rob Davies said many companies were forced to wait more than 90 days for payment by public entities. This despite the Public Finance Management Act requiring that public entities pay in 30 days.
"The impact of the crisis on small business is not known but we know it's profound," he said.
While access to government procurements was competitive, experience had shown that dealing with the state came hand in hand with late or non-payments.
The reasons included contracts not being properly signed and companies not receiving their tax clearance certificates.
